    My love of all things Finn began when I saw Split Enz at Imperial College, London on 27 November 1976, just a few weeks after beginning my degree course there. (I think Neil had joined the band by then.) I joined the BBC in late 1979 and worked at Television Centre as a studio engineer for several years - this edition of TOTP was recorded there. I worked on many TOTPs (usually recorded on a Wednesday) including some editions we did live, but I don't recall this show so it was probably a shift off day for me. Fun times. And all these years later, I'm now (30 Aug 2017) catching up with Neil's recent Infinity sessions on RUclips. Thanks, Neil and Tim.
